A Framework for Evaluating the VISSIM Traffic Simulation with Extended Range Telepresence

Pèrez Arias, Antonia; Kretz, Tobias; Ehrhardt, Peter; Hengst, Stefan; Vortisch, Peter; Hanebeck, Uwe D.

Abstract:

This paper presents a novel framework for combining traffic simulations and extended range telepresence. The real user's position data can thus be used for validation and calibration of models of pedestrian dynamics, while the user experiences a high degree of immersion by interacting with agents in realistic simulations.
